How Can You Determine the Right Size for a Ruler May Ring?
To determine the right size for a ruler may ring, measure the circumference of your finger and consider the width of the band.
To accurately find the right size for a ruler may ring, follow these detailed steps:
-
Measure Finger Circumference: Use a measuring tape or a piece of string to measure around the base of your finger. The measurement should be snug but not too tight. This measurement gives you the circumference, which is crucial for sizing.
-
Refer to Size Charts: Once you have the circumference, compare your measurement to standard ring size charts. Each size corresponds to a specific circumference in millimeters. Most online retailers provide sizing charts for reference.
-
Consider Band Width: Wider bands fit differently than narrower bands. If you choose a thicker band, it’s advisable to go up half a size for a more comfortable fit. A study in the Journal of Fashion Technology & Textile Engineering (Smith et al., 2020) supports this by noting that wider rings exert more pressure on fingers.
-
Use Ring Sizers: Consider using a ring sizer, which is a set of plastic or metal rings in various sizes. This allows you to try different sizes to find the most comfortable fit.
-
Account for Temperature: Keep in mind that finger size can change with temperature. Fingers may swell in heat and shrink in cold weather. Measuring your finger at room temperature gives the most accurate size.
-
Consult with a Jeweler: If unsure, visiting a professional jeweler is a reliable option. Jewelers can measure your finger accurately and recommend the perfect size based on your preferences.
By taking these steps, you can confidently choose the right size for a ruler may ring, ensuring a comfortable fit that suits your style.

How Can You Properly Care for Your Ruler May Ring to Ensure Longevity?
To ensure the longevity of your Ruler May ring, proper care involves regular cleaning, careful storage, and avoiding exposure to harsh chemicals.
Regular cleaning: Clean your ring periodically to remove dirt and oils. Use mild soap and warm water. Soak it for ten minutes, then gently scrub with a soft brush to reach intricate designs. Rinse thoroughly and dry with a soft cloth to maintain shine.
Careful storage: Store your ring in a cool, dry place. Avoid exposing it to moisture, which can lead to tarnishing. Use a fabric-lined jewelry box or a soft pouch to prevent scratches and damage when not worn.
Avoiding harsh chemicals: Keep your ring away from chemicals found in cleaning products, lotions, and perfumes. These substances can damage the metal and gemstones. If you must use these products, put your ring on after your skin is completely dry.
By following these care instructions, you can enhance the durability and aesthetic of your Ruler May ring, ensuring it retains its beauty for years to come.
